[w3ctag/design-reviews] Behavior of the "disabled" attribute for HTMLLinkElement (#519)

Hello TAG!

I'm requesting a TAG review of the behavior of the "disabled" attribute for HTMLLinkElement.

This request is being made at the suggestion of @slightlyoff in this [Intent to Ship thread](https://groups.google.com/a/chromium.org/d/msg/blink-dev/3izM5vVo98U/iDLjz_TwAgAJ). This change is an interop-improvement, as the "disabled" attribute was previously poorly specified, and implementations differed. There is a more general need to specify the "disabled" attribute for HTMLStyleElement and SVGStyleElement, and this is discussed [here](https://github.com/whatwg/html/issues/1081) and [here](https://bugs.chromium.org/p/chromium/issues/detail?id=695984). Perhaps the TAG could weigh in on either the HTMLLinkElement specifically, or these issues generally?

  - Explainer¹ : https://github.com/whatwg/html/issues/3840 (actually just the issue thread)
  - Specification URL: https://github.com/whatwg/html/pull/4519 (a PR)
  - Tests: https://wpt.fyi/results/css/cssom?label=master&label=experimental&aligned=&q=htmllinkelement-disabled

  - Security and Privacy self-review²: N/A
  - GitHub repo (if you prefer feedback filed there): N/A
  - Primary contacts (and their relationship to the specification):
      - Mason Freed (@mfreed7), Google
      - Emilio Cobos Álvarez (@emilio), Mozilla
  - Organization(s)/project(s) driving the specification: Google, Mozilla 
  - Key pieces of existing multi-stakeholder review or discussion of this specification: https://github.com/whatwg/html/issues/3840 
  - External status/issue trackers for this specification: https://chromestatus.com/feature/5110851973414912


Further details:

  - [X] I have reviewed the TAG's [API Design Principles](https://w3ctag.github.io/design-principles/)
  - Relevant time constraints or deadlines: None
  - The group where the work on this specification is currently being done: WhatWG
  - The group where standardization of this work is intended to be done: WhatWG
  - Major unresolved issues with or opposition to this specification: Just compat
  - This work is being funded by: Google/Mozilla

We'd prefer the TAG provide feedback as (please delete all but the desired option):

  💬 leave review feedback as a **comment in this issue** and @-notify @mfreed7, @emilio


-- 
You are receiving this because you are subscribed to this thread.
Reply to this email directly or view it on GitHub:
https://github.com/w3ctag/design-reviews/issues/519

Received on Friday, 29 May 2020 21:56:29 UTC